Статус: Новичок
Группы: Участники
Зарегистрирован: 12.04.2019(UTC) Сообщений: 3
|
добрый день задача - скопировать контейнер с флешки в реестр компьютера, при этом имя контейнера не меняется. через командную строку: csptest -keycopy -machinesrc -contsrc "\\.\FAT12_E\имя_контейнера" -machinedest -contdest "\\.\REGISTRY\имя_контейнера" -pindest "" выдает ошибку ...\trunk\trunk_0\csp\samples\csptest\keycopy.c:284:AcquireContext(destination) Error 0x8009000f: Объект уже существует. версии csptest пробовал разные, от 4ки до 5.0r3, везде эта ошибка при этом, если поменять имя контейнера в назначении - копирование без проблем. потом сразу же повторное копирование из реестра в реестр с изначальным именем - тоже без проблем. просьба исправить csptesp или ткнуть в ошибку написания команды :)
|
|
|
|
Статус: Сотрудник
Группы: Участники
Зарегистрирован: 30.06.2016(UTC) Сообщений: 3,478   Сказал «Спасибо»: 53 раз Поблагодарили: 801 раз в 740 постах
|
Автор: oldscratch  добрый день задача - скопировать контейнер с флешки в реестр компьютера, при этом имя контейнера не меняется. через командную строку: csptest -keycopy -machinesrc -contsrc "\\.\FAT12_E\имя_контейнера" -machinedest -contdest "\\.\REGISTRY\имя_контейнера" -pindest "" выдает ошибку ...\trunk\trunk_0\csp\samples\csptest\keycopy.c:284:AcquireContext(destination) Error 0x8009000f: Объект уже существует. версии csptest пробовал разные, от 4ки до 5.0r3, везде эта ошибка при этом, если поменять имя контейнера в назначении - копирование без проблем. потом сразу же повторное копирование из реестра в реестр с изначальным именем - тоже без проблем. просьба исправить csptesp или ткнуть в ошибку написания команды :) Здравствуйте. Если Вы скопировали ключевой контейнер с заданным именем копии, то скопировать еще раз с таким же именем копии нельзя (в рамках одного считывателя - реестр, USB-флеш и т.п.) - такой ключевой контейнер уже существует (о чем и говорит сообщение об ошибке). |
|
|
|
|
Статус: Сотрудник
Группы: Участники
Зарегистрирован: 12.08.2013(UTC) Сообщений: 834   Откуда: Москва Сказал «Спасибо»: 5 раз Поблагодарили: 215 раз в 174 постах
|
Добрый день. Проверил на CSP 5.0 R3 - копируется без проблем. Может, какая-то проблема с тем, что вы копируете ключи не пользователю, а в local_machine? Убедитесь под админом, что в [HKEY_LOCAL_MACHINE\SOFTWARE\WOW6432Node\Crypto Pro\Settings\Keys] нет этого ключа. |
|
|
|
|
Статус: Новичок
Группы: Участники
Зарегистрирован: 12.04.2019(UTC) Сообщений: 3
|
убрал ключ -machinesrc, т.е. как бы копирую из "пользовательского" контейнера в контейнер компьютера - все проходит без ошибок. естественно, контейнера в реестре при этом не существует. возможно глюк связан с осью - win xp ))) на более новых не проверял, обошел исключением ключа. флешка - виртуальная, созданная imdisk'ом.
|
|
|
|
Статус: Новичок
Группы: Участники
Зарегистрирован: 12.04.2019(UTC) Сообщений: 3
|
Автор: Александр Лавник  Здравствуйте.
Если Вы скопировали ключевой контейнер с заданным именем копии, то скопировать еще раз с таким же именем копии нельзя (в рамках одного считывателя - реестр, USB-флеш и т.п.) - такой ключевой контейнер уже существует (о чем и говорит сообщение об ошибке). так в том и проблема, что считыватели разные. флешка и реестр. вот такая конструкция сразу же работает без проблем! похоже, что csptesp не учитывает имя считывателя. в моем - видимо локальном - случае. csptest -keycopy -machinesrc -contsrc "\\.\FAT12_E\имя_контейнера" -machinedest -contdest "\\.\REGISTRY\имя_контейнера_копия" -pindest "" csptest -keycopy -machinesrc -contsrc "\\.\REGISTRY\имя_контейнера_копия" -machinedest -contdest "\\.\REGISTRY\имя_контейнера" -pindest ""
|
|
|
|
Быстрый переход
Вы не можете создавать новые темы в этом форуме.
Вы не можете отвечать в этом форуме.
Вы не можете удалять Ваши сообщения в этом форуме.
Вы не можете редактировать Ваши сообщения в этом форуме.
Вы не можете создавать опросы в этом форуме.
Вы не можете голосовать в этом форуме.
Important Information:
The Форум КриптоПро uses cookies. By continuing to browse this site, you are agreeing to our use of cookies.
More Details
Close